
A Jeopardy! contestant confused Jack White with fellow Detroit native Eminem last night (Jan. 11). In response to host Alex Trebek’s question, “A recent vinyl resurgence has been aided by this musician, who built a pressing plant in his Detroit hometown,” the contestant quickly mistook rocker White for rapper Eminem.
The hilarity of this moment lies in the fact that the question was accompanied by a photo of The White Stripes rocker, donning a fedora, a razor sharp goatee, and maybe the thinnest mustache ever. The contestant’s blunder was picked up by another competitor on the show, who swiftly answered correctly.
White’s new Detroit record plant, Third Man Pressing, has brought a sense of resurgence to the storied musical city that had fallen on financial hard times over the past decade. The new plant/record store threw a grand opening party last February, featuring performances from another Motor City artist, Danny Brown.
